Apply lotion as tolerated.Decubitus ulcers may develop from pressure of being bedbound, decreased nutritional status.Red spots to bony prominences are first signs of Stage I decubiti and open sores may develop.Relieve pressure to bony prominences or other areas of breakdown with turning and positioning Q2 hrs if tolerated.
